How much do salesforce tester j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for salesforce tester in the United States is $47.54,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$37.50 and $56.01 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Salesforce Tester position, and why are they important?

A Salesforce Tester should possess strong analytical skills, experience in software testing methodologies, and a solid understanding of Salesforce platform features and workflows. Familiarity with testing tools like Selenium, Jira, and Salesforce-specific diagnostic tools, as well as certifications such as Salesforce Certified Administrator or Platform App Builder, is highly beneficial. Att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ication are important soft skills that enhance performance in this role. These competencies ensure accurate testing of Salesforce solutions, smooth collaboration with development teams, and delivery of high-quality, error-free products.

What is a Salesforce Tester job?

A Salesforce Tester is responsible for ensuring the quality and functionality of Salesforce applications by performing various types of testing, such as functional, regression, integration, and user acceptance testing. They create test plans, write test cases, execute tests, and identify defects to ensure the system meets business requirements. Salesforce Testers work closely with developers, business analysts, and administrators to validate configurations, customizations, and integrations within the Salesforce ecosystem. Their role is crucial in maintaining the stability and performance of Salesforce implementations.

What types of projects or tasks does a Salesforce Tester typically handle on a daily basis?

A Salesforce Tester is responsible for designing, executing, and documenting test cases to verify the functionality of customizations, integrations, and workflows within the Salesforce platform. Daily tasks often include collaborating with developers and business analysts to understand requirements, identifying and tracking bugs, and conducting regression, functional, and user acceptance testing. Additionally, Salesforce Testers may work across multiple projects simultaneously, adapting testing approaches for both new features and enhancements to existing solutions. This role often requires proactive communication with cross-functional teams to ensure that released Salesforce applications meet organizational standards and user expectations.
